Ghana's population is estimated by the United Nations to be 34.1 million in 2021.
The population of Ghana grew at 2.1% in the last year and is ranked the 13th most populated country in Africa, ahead of Mozambique.
Ghana last conducted a national census in 2021 and 70.6% of births in Ghana are recorded. Read more from the World Econcomics Population Data Quality Ratings and see how Ghana compares to other countries around the world and in the Africa region.
